Early Life & Background

Linda Susan Agar was born on 30 January 1948 in Santa Monica, California. Her birth came during a very public period in her mother’s life. Shirley Temple had already become a household name years earlier as the curly-haired child star who helped define Hollywood’s Golden Age.

Linda’s father, John Agar, was also part of the film world. He became known for acting roles in westerns, war films, and science fiction productions. His marriage to Shirley Temple brought him even more attention, especially because Shirley had been one of America’s most recognizable performers since childhood.

Linda was born into fame, but not into an ordinary kind of fame. Her mother was not just an actress; she was a cultural figure. Shirley Temple’s image had been part of American popular life since the 1930s. So, from the beginning, Linda’s identity was connected to a family name that carried enormous public curiosity.

However, her parents’ marriage did not last. Shirley Temple and John Agar married in 1945, welcomed Linda in 1948, and later divorced in 1950. After that, Shirley Temple married Charles Alden Black, and her family life moved into a new chapter.

Family & Personal Life

Family is the most important part of Linda Susan Agar’s public story. Her mother, Shirley Temple, was one of the most successful child stars in Hollywood history. After acting, Shirley Temple later became involved in public service and diplomacy, giving her life a second chapter far beyond entertainment.

Her father, John Agar, was an American actor whose career included films such as westerns, war dramas, and science-fiction titles. He was Shirley Temple’s first husband and Linda’s biological father.

After Shirley Temple’s divorce from John Agar, she married Charles Alden Black. Through that marriage, Linda had two maternal half-siblings: Charles Alden Black Jr. and Lori Black. Lori Black later became known in music circles as a bassist.

On her father’s side, Linda also had half-siblings from John Agar’s later marriage, including Martin Agar and John G. Agar III.
